Many roles in this vibrant field are not advertised widely, making it essential to understand where to look and how to position yourself effectively. Q: What are some hidden job roles in the arts sector for business graduates?
A: Hidden job roles in the arts sector for business graduates include positions like arts administrator, gallery manager, and project coordinator for arts organizations. These roles often focus on the operational and managerial aspects of running art institutions, such as museums, theaters, and galleries.
Additionally, roles in fundraising, marketing, and event management are vital yet frequently overlooked opportunities where business graduates can excel. Q: How can I find these hidden job opportunities in the arts? A: To discover hidden job opportunities in the arts, network extensively within the industry by attending exhibitions, performances, and industry events.
